Main Notification Groups You Can Control

Spinfin Casino arranges its alerts into well-defined categories. This covers everything that could be relevant, but you decide what remains and what goes. The main groups encompass your money, bonuses, new games, and special offers. You can turn any single category on or off. Perhaps you love slots and want to get notified about every new release, but you aren’t interested in live dealer news. You can set it up exactly that way. This categorical selection is the heart of the system. It lets you create a notification feed that fits you and only you.

  • Financial Transactions: Instant notifications on deposits, successful withdrawals, and any transaction failures.
  • Bonus & Promotion Status: Notifications for new bonus eligibility, wagering requirement progress, and impending offer expirations.
  • Game Library Updates: Updates for new game releases, especially from preferred providers or within favorite genres.
  • Account Security: Important notifications for login attempts, password changes, and account verification status.
  • Personalized Offers: Tailored promotions based on your play history, delivered as direct notifications.
  • Session & Limit Alerts: Custom notifications for gameplay duration or loss limits, supporting responsible gaming.
  • Tournament & Leaderboard Updates: Critical alerts for competition start times, rank changes, and prize claims.

Setting up Your Alerts: An Easy Guide

Configuring your alerts on Spinfin Casino is straightforward. The process is designed for you to manage on your own. To get the best fit, take a methodical approach. Start by going to the ‘My Account’ area and select the ‘Notifications’ tab. You’ll see the whole layout of categories and channels. A solid method is to first turn on all the main categories that interest you. Then, go back and meticulously pick the delivery method for each one. Your needs will evolve, so plan to revisit these settings every few months. Including this as a regular step of your account upkeep keeps the system working perfectly for you.

  1. Sign in to your Spinfin Casino account and access your account settings.
  2. Locate and select the ‘Notification Preferences’ or ‘Alert Settings’ menu.
  3. Review the list of available alert categories (Financial, Bonuses, Games, etc.).
  4. For each category, set the alert to ‘On’ and pick your preferred delivery channel(s): In-App, Email, and/or SMS.
  5. For financial alerts, you might have the option to set custom monetary thresholds.
  6. Apply your changes. Your preferences are activated instantly.
  7. Conduct a test by triggering a low-stakes alert, like a small deposit, to confirm your channel choices.
